Netfullin remembered how Swedish fans prevented CSKA players from sleeping at night

Torpedo Moscow midfielder Ravil Netfullin told how Swedish fans prevented CSKA players from sleeping before the match with AIK in the Europa League.

“Even on the bench you could feel the level. I remember that stadium in Stockholm, the stands were full. For me, everything was still developing so rapidly. It seems like I was recently in the reserve team, and now I’m in the main team, European Cups. Swedish fans prevented CSKA players from sleeping at night. As a result, we lost to AIK and were eliminated from the Europa League,” Netfullin quotes “RB Sport”.

The 31-year-old Russian is the champion of Russia and the winner of the national Cup as part of the red-blue team.

This season the midfielder plays for Torpedo. He played 13 matches for the team in the First League, scored three goals and provided four assists. His contract with the club runs until June 30, 2025.
